"Baker will never win": NFL fans roast Baker Mayfield for trash-talking an All-Pro star he struggled against

Netflix's "Quarterback" series has once again started conversations across the NFL. This time, it involves Tampa Bay Buccaneers quarterback Baker Mayfield and Philadelphia Eagles cornerback Quinyon Mitchell.

A clip from Netflix's Quarterback series showed an exchange between Buccaneers' QB Baker Mayfield and Eagles' CB Quinyon Mitchell during a game, but what drew more attention was the reaction from the fans after they revisited how the matchup actually ended.

"#Bucs QB Baker Mayfield trash-talking with Eagles CB Quinyon Mitchell: Baker: “Who the f*** are you, anyway?”, Quinyon: “You know who I am.” Baker: “No, I don’t.” Ari Meirov, an NFL insider, posted on X.

NFL insider Ari Meirov posted on X about the exchange between Mayfield and Mitchell. Many Eagles fans appreciated Mitchell's calm response, especially because he let his game talk.

Others turned the spotlight back on Baker Mayfield, arguing that his trash talk did not age well once the numbers were on the board.

Fans flooded social media with remarks like "Baker will never win," while others joked that Quinyon Mitchell had let his performance do all the talking.

Consequently, Quinyon Mitchell has already experienced as much postseason football in two seasons as Baker Mayfield has across his entire career.

Mitchell started all four playoff games during the Philadelphia Eagles' Super Bowl-winning 2024 campaign and followed it up with another postseason appearance in last year's Wild Card defeat to the San Francisco 49ers.

Mayfield's record tells a different story. The veteran quarterback owns a 2-3 record as a postseason starter over eight NFL seasons and is still chasing the Lombardi Trophy that Mitchell already has on his shelf.

In terms of statistics, Mitchell had every reason to feel confident. Mayfield completed just 2 of 9 passes for six yards when he targeted receivers covered by Mitchell during their Week 4 game.

Numerous fans stated numbers while making fun of Mayfield, suggesting he should have recognized exactly who Mitchell was after struggling to generate offense against him.
